Lines Matching refs:dchan

898 static void xilinx_dma_free_chan_resources(struct dma_chan *dchan)  in xilinx_dma_free_chan_resources()  argument
900 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_free_chan_resources()
1081 static int xilinx_dma_alloc_chan_resources(struct dma_chan *dchan) in xilinx_dma_alloc_chan_resources() argument
1083 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_alloc_chan_resources()
1184 dma_cookie_init(dchan); in xilinx_dma_alloc_chan_resources()
1237 static enum dma_status xilinx_dma_tx_status(struct dma_chan *dchan, in xilinx_dma_tx_status() argument
1241 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_tx_status()
1247 ret = dma_cookie_status(dchan, cookie, txstate); in xilinx_dma_tx_status()
1648 static void xilinx_dma_issue_pending(struct dma_chan *dchan) in xilinx_dma_issue_pending() argument
1650 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_issue_pending()
1663 static int xilinx_dma_device_config(struct dma_chan *dchan, in xilinx_dma_device_config() argument
2002 xilinx_vdma_dma_prep_interleaved(struct dma_chan *dchan, in xilinx_vdma_dma_prep_interleaved() argument
2006 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_vdma_dma_prep_interleaved()
2085 xilinx_cdma_prep_memcpy(struct dma_chan *dchan, dma_addr_t dma_dst, in xilinx_cdma_prep_memcpy() argument
2088 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_cdma_prep_memcpy()
2142 struct dma_chan *dchan, struct scatterlist *sgl, unsigned int sg_len, in xilinx_dma_prep_slave_sg() argument
2146 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_prep_slave_sg()
2241 struct dma_chan *dchan, dma_addr_t buf_addr, size_t buf_len, in xilinx_dma_prep_dma_cyclic() argument
2245 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_prep_dma_cyclic()
2348 xilinx_mcdma_prep_slave_sg(struct dma_chan *dchan, struct scatterlist *sgl, in xilinx_mcdma_prep_slave_sg() argument
2353 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_mcdma_prep_slave_sg()
2440 static int xilinx_dma_terminate_all(struct dma_chan *dchan) in xilinx_dma_terminate_all() argument
2442 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_terminate_all()
2476 static void xilinx_dma_synchronize(struct dma_chan *dchan) in xilinx_dma_synchronize() argument
2478 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_dma_synchronize()
2496 int xilinx_vdma_channel_set_config(struct dma_chan *dchan, in xilinx_vdma_channel_set_config() argument
2499 struct xilinx_dma_chan *chan = to_xilinx_chan(dchan); in xilinx_vdma_channel_set_config()